PHP圖形計數器程式顯示網站使用者瀏覽量

來源:互聯網
上載者:User
這篇文章主要為大家分享了PHP圖形計數器程式,直觀的顯示網站使用者瀏覽量,感興趣的小夥伴們可以參考一下

PHP圖形計數器程式是一款簡單的圖片計數器,為了直觀顯示一個網站有多少使用者瀏覽,需要在網頁底部放一個圖片計數器,也就是當前頁面的訪問量,訪問量的資料是儲存在 txt 檔案裡,可自動產生 num.txt 檔案,自訂初始資料,顯示的數字圖片儲存在 img 目錄下,可以換成自己做的精美的圖片,更換即可,index.php是調用檔案,很簡單。

本程式只有幾十KB,系統代碼設計簡單易懂。

效果如下:

關於程式的安裝很簡單:

1、這款圖形計數器不需要資料庫的支援,只要能運行PHP即可,將index.php裡的PHP檔案拷貝到需要的網頁裡面即可,其它檔案不動。

2、檔案的結構:

(1),index.php,調用計數器檔案

<?phpecho "您是第"; require("count.php"); echo "位訪客"; ?>

(2),count.php 圖形計數器的核心代碼

<?php $path= "img";//圖片所在的檔案夾子, img 是在相應檔案夾下 $f_name = "num.txt";//計數器的資料儲存在num.txt $n_digit = 10; //如果檔案不存在,則建立檔案,初始值置為100/ if(!file_exists($f_name)){ $fp=fopen($f_name,"w"); fputs($fp,"100"); fclose($fp); } $fp=fopen($f_name,"r"); //開啟num.txt檔案 $hits=fgets($fp,$n_digit); //開始計取資料 fclose($fp); //關閉檔案 $hits=(int)$hits + 1;//計數器增加1 $hits=(string)$hits;  $fp=fopen($f_name,"w"); fputs($fp,$hits);//寫入新的計數 fclose($fp); //關閉檔案 //迴圈讀取並顯示出圖形計數器 for($i=0;$i<$n_digit;$i++)  $hits = str_replace("$i","<img src='$path/$i.gif' $alt>","$hits"); echo $hits;  ?>

(3) num.txt 儲存計數的檔案

訪問量的資料是儲存在 txt 檔案裡,可自動產生 num.txt 檔案,自訂初始資料

(4) img/ 儲存0-9的圖形檔案

源碼下載,開始你的php圖片計數器系統學習之旅吧!

小提示:本系統開發尚不完善,還存在許多欠缺,但會繼續努力進行完善。

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.